In recent years, growing interest in direct current (DC) microgrids led to increased research and standardization efforts. In this context, previous research suggests that power quality (PQ) will improve compared to alternating current (AC) microgrids. However, PQ indicators still lack consistent definitions. Within this study, different PQ indicators are compared experimentally. To evaluate and analyze PQ, a branch of an industrial DC microgrid is used. Measurements are taken using a contactor with integrated monitoring and measurement technology. The acquired data is analyzed locally with respect to periodic and non-periodic PQ indicators. Compared to an oscilloscope, the intelligent contactor reliably captured mean and RMS voltage values in all conditions. This underlines the advantages of using an intelligent contactor for monitoring in a DC microgrid.
